Course Content

• Introduction to Augmented Reality (AR) and its Applications in Forensics
• AR Evidence Collection: Best Practices and Ethical Considerations
• 3D Modeling and Reconstruction using AR for Crime Scene Investigation
• AR-based Evidence Documentation and Presentation in Court
• Utilizing AR for Crime Scene Photography and Videography
• Data Security and Privacy in AR-based Evidence Management
• Advanced AR Techniques for Fingerprint and Trace Evidence Analysis
• Case Studies: Successful Applications of AR in Real-World Investigations
• Legal Aspects of AR Evidence Admissibility
• Future Trends and Developments in AR Forensic Technology
